What is an Incline Treadmill?
An incline treadmill is a type of [Treadmill That Inclines](https://www.carleyherbold.top/health/revolutionize-your-workout-routine-with-the-ultimate-foldable-treadmill-featuring-incline-technology/) that permits users to change the angle of the running surface, imitating the experience of running or walking uphill. This function sets incline treadmills apart from conventional flat treadmills, using a variety of advantages that improve total exercise programs. Users can usually elevate the incline from 0% (flat) to as steep as 15% or more, depending upon the design.
Types of Incline Treadmills
Before delving into the benefits of using an incline treadmill, it's necessary to comprehend the different types available:

Manual Incline Treadmills: These designs need the user to adjust the incline by hand. They are usually more economical but lack the sophisticated features found in motorized designs.

Motorized Incline Treadmills: Equipped with electronic controls, motorized treadmills enable users to change the incline with the push of a button. They frequently include preset workout programs customized to different physical fitness objectives.

Industrial Incline Treadmills: Often utilized in fitness centers and gym, these treadmills are developed for resilience and come with sophisticated functions, including large screens and comprehensive workout programs.

Folding Incline Treadmills: Ideal for those with minimal space, these treadmills can be folded after use while still providing incline functionality.
Advantages of Using an Incline Treadmill
Incline treadmills provide a myriad of benefits that can positively impact a person's fitness journey. Here are some significant advantages:
1. Increased Caloric Burn
Utilizing an incline treadmill substantially increases calorie expense compared to walking or operating on a flat surface area. Research studies recommend that users can burn up to 50% more calories when exercising on an incline. This makes incline treadmills an excellent alternative for those seeking to shed pounds or keep a healthy weight.
2. Boosted Cardiovascular Fitness
Incline exercises elevate the heart rate and offer an excellent cardio exercise. Improved cardiovascular fitness can lead to much better heart health, increased endurance, and overall health.
3. Muscle Engagement
Running or walking on an incline engages various muscle groups, particularly the calves, hamstrings, and glutes. The activation of these muscles assists construct strength and enhances toning.
4. Joint-Friendly Workouts
Incline treadmills mitigate some influence on the joints compared to running on more difficult surfaces. The incline can motivate a more natural stride and reduce the propensity to heel strike, thus making it a more effective option for people with joint concerns.
5. Flexible Training Options
Incline treadmills provide a variety of training alternatives, making them suitable for users with varying physical fitness levels:

Getting the most out of an incline treadmill requires understanding of how to use it correctly. Here are some suggestions for making the most of workouts:

Start Slow: Beginners should gradually acclimate to the incline. Beginning with a moderate incline for much shorter durations can assist prevent injury.

Engage Core Muscles: For improved stability and assistance, actively engage core muscles throughout exercises.

Maintain Proper Form: Keep shoulders relaxed, head up, and utilize a natural arm movement to match the stride.

Hydration and Recovery: Ensure sufficient hydration before, during, and after your workout. Enable healing days to assist muscles recover.

Set Goals: Whether focusing on weight-loss, cardiovascular physical fitness, or muscle tone, setting attainable objectives can assist keep the workout routine structured and motivating.

2. How typically should I use an incline treadmill?
Frequency can vary based on specific fitness levels, however incorporating incline treadmill exercises 3 to 5 times weekly is generally adequate for a lot of users.
3. Can incline treadmills assist with weight reduction?
Definitely! Incline workouts can substantially increase calorie burn, making them an outstanding part of a weight-loss method when combined with a well balanced diet.
4. What is the ideal incline for novices?
Beginners need to begin with a low incline (1-3%) to acclimate to the exercise before gradually increasing it as they become more comfortable.
5. Do incline treadmills require a lot of upkeep?
Many incline treadmills require very little maintenance. Regular cleaning, examining the belt alignment, and guaranteeing lubrication can keep the machine operating optimally.
